SHOPPERS braved the rain, traffic queues and endless Christmas tunes in shops to get those last minute presents and Christmas dinner.

The weekend wasn’t a total washout, indoor shopping centres, such as Kingsgate Centre, were bustling as shoppers did their best to escape a distinctly un-festive drenching. And up to 120,000 shoppers headed to Meadowhall to escape the rain.

As a nation it’s predicted we spent £5billion over the weekend gearing up for the big day – that’s a lot of Christmas pudding!

However, not everyone will be able to spend the day getting merry with family and friends.

There are some people working to make sure we can have a safe Christmas – Blue Watch at Huddersfield Fire Station will be there if things go very wrong in the kitchen, doctors will be at Huddersfield Royal Infirmary’s Accident and Emergency for those who fall ill or get injured. And the police will be on hand in case trouble flares.

There’s also the likes of taxi drivers, pub landlords and the team up at Emley TV mast who will make sure we don’t miss our favourite festive TV.
